[Marxism] Lessons from Hurricane Ivan
Last year, Hurricane Ivan hit Cuba and then New Orleans. In Cuba, 1.3
million people, more than 10% of the population, were evacuated without a
single lost life.
I've written up the lessons of Hurricane Ivan that were learned in Cuba, and
also that were learned (or, rather, SHOULD have been learned) in New Orleans
LESS THAN A YEAR AGO, here:
